Caesars and DraftKings Offer $100 No Deposit Bonus for Louisiana Bettors

Caesars and DraftKings are both offering sports fans in Louisiana a $100 pre-registration bonus to encourage them to sign up ahead of the launch date.

Caesars, DraftKings, and FanDuel have all gained licenses to launch online sportsbooks in Louisiana. The industry is expected to begin in mid-January 2022.

Competition for customers is already fierce, so Caesars and DraftKings are keen to register players ahead of the launch date. To that end, both operators are providing generous pre-launch bonuses.

When Will Louisiana Online Sports Betting Begin?

Voters in 55 of 64 Louisiana parishes decided to legalize sports betting in the November 2020 ballot. The Louisiana Gaming Control Board has been laying the groundwork for the legal industry to begin ever since then.

Chairman Ronnie Johns has signed eight retail sports betting licenses. Two Caesars Sportsbook sites opened on October 31, and they were soon joined by DraftKings retail sportsbooks and Penn National Gaming Sportsbooks.

Caesars, DraftKings and FanDuel have all been cleared to launch online, but they are awaiting a start date. It was initially hoped that the industry could begin this year, but Johns now says he hopes for an early January 2022 start date. It should be up and running in time for the Super Bowl.
